4th Birthday Volcano Cake with Fondant Dinosaurs

Our older son just turned four and asked for a volcano cake with dinosaurs. We had great fun making this!

I baked two chocolate sponge cakes which we cut into a volcano shape and poured melted chocolate over. Once the chocolate set we added red fondant lava.

I made a T-Rex, Stegosaurus, Dimetrodon, Triceratops, Parasaurolophus and Pterodactyl from colored fondant. We had a very happy four year old!

PV Solar Panel Payback Calculator

We've made a PV Solar Panel Payback Calculator which you can use to work out what return you could get by investing in solar panels versus leaving the cash in a savings account.

Here's an example graph for a 3.76kWh system with the following assumptions:
Cost of system = 3.76 x 4000 = £15040
System output: 3008 kWh/year
Tax rate: 40%
Savings rate: 5%
RPI: 3%
Annual increase in elec cost: 6%
Percentage of generated electricity which is used: 50%
Cost of a unit of electricity: 12p
And we'll won't treat the solar panels as an asset (i.e. we'll say they have 100% initial depreciation).

3.76kWp Solar PV Payback

Payback for Solar pv

We've written a squidoo lens on how to evaluate payback of solar pv panels in the UK. We cover how the government feed in tariffs work. And show how to calculate whether solar pv makes sense for you.

Extract "The UK government has recently introduced Feed-In-Tariffs (FiTs). FiTs provide tax-free, index-linked payments for 25 years. These payments mean that it can actually make financial sense to install photovoltaic (PV) solar panels on your roof. It won't make you rich, but when considered along with the environmental benefits it can be worthwhile.

The potential payout is dependent on many factors. We'll take you through the factors and give figures for some samples systems so you can get an idea of how much money you can make from solar PV."
